Outdoor Essential: Why Shade Glasses Are Non-Negotiable
We all love sunny days, but prolonged exposure to UV radiation can seriously harm your eyes. Think cataracts, macular degeneration, and painful photokeratitis (like sunburn for your corneas!). High-quality shade glasses act like a superhero cape for your eyes. They block up to 100% of UVA and UVB rays, filtering intense light to prevent squinting, eye strain, and long-term damage. Look for labels confirming UV400 protection – that's the gold standard, guarding against all light wavelengths up to 400 nanometers. Never compromise on UV protection; it's the core reason to wear them!
Beyond Basic Protection: Fashion Meets Function
Today's shade glasses are style powerhouses. Forget clunky, limited options. Modern frames come in endless shapes: classic aviators, timeless wayfarers, sleek cat-eyes, sporty wraparounds, and trendy oversized designs. Lens technology has also evolved dramatically. Beyond essential UV blockage, advanced options include:
- Polarized Lenses: Eliminate blinding glare bouncing off water, snow, or roads, enhancing clarity and reducing eye fatigue – ideal for driving or watersports.
- Photochromic Lenses: Transition automatically from clear to dark outdoors. Perfect if you regularly move between indoor and outdoor environments. Works great for prescription shade glasses too.
- Mirrored Lenses: Add a stylish edge while offering extra light reduction and some glare protection. Very popular for outdoor activities.
- Gradient Lenses: Darker at the top and lighter at the bottom, great for general wear and driving.
Choosing Your Perfect Pair of Shade Glasses
Finding your ideal shade glasses involves more than just picking the coolest look. Consider:
- Fit: They should sit comfortably on your nose and ears without pinching or slipping. Enough coverage to block light from the sides and top is vital.
- Lens Color: Gray/Brown/Green lenses offer true color perception and are great all-rounders. Amber/copper enhance contrast (good for outdoor sports). Yellow/rose excel in low-light or overcast conditions.
- Your Lifestyle: Active outdoors? Prioritize polarized lenses, wraparound styles, and durable materials (like lightweight nylon frames). Fashion-focused? Explore the full range of luxury and trendy designer shade glasses. Need prescription? Look for quality options from reputed eyewear brands.
- Quality: Invest in well-made frames and authentic lenses. Cheap plastic often lacks proper UV protection and distorts your vision. Trust established brands or retailers who guarantee UV protection levels.
